Long-term lumasiran therapy final results from a Phase 2 open-label extension study in primary hyperoxaluria

ABSTRACT Background Primary hyperoxaluria type 1 (PH1) is a rare genetic disorder of hepatic oxalate overproduction leading to kidney failure and systemic oxalosis. Lumasiran is an RNA interference therapeutic approved for lowering urinary oxalate (UOx) and plasma oxalate (POx) in PH1. This Phase 2 open-label extension (OLE) study evaluated the safety and efficacy of long-term lumasiran treatment (up to 54 months) in patients with PH1 who had completed the Phase 1/2 parent study. Methods The Phase 2 OLE (NCT03350451) included patients with PH1 6 to 64 years of age, 24-hour UOx excretion >0.7 mmol/1.73 m2/day, and estimated glomerular filtration rate (eGFR >45 ml/min/1.73 m2) who enrolled within 12 months of parent study completion. Patients initiated subcutaneous lumasiran at parent study dosage. Endpoints included adverse event (AE) incidence (primary) and change over time in efficacy measures, including 24-hour UOx and eGFR. Results All 20 patients (median age 11.5 years; 65% female) who completed the parent study entered and completed the Phase 2 OLE. Of 21 treatment-related AEs over 427 doses, 13 were transient injection site reactions (ISRs), affecting 8/20 patients (40%); all ISRs were mild in severity. After Month (M) 18 through M51 (last dosing), no ISRs were reported. No treatment-related severe or serious AEs were reported. Lumasiran treatment led to a substantial mean reduction in 24-hour UOx from baseline to M54 of −1.5 mmol/24 h/1.73 m2. At visits M42 through M54, 24-hour UOx was ≤1.5 × ULN in 89%–94% of patients at each visit. The mean annual change in eGFR was −0.4 ml/min/1.73 m2/year overall; eGFR was also stable in those patients with baseline eGFR <90 ml/min/1.73 m2. Conclusion These data represent the longest published follow-up of lumasiran-treated patients with PH1 (ages 6–43 years) to date. Long-term lumasiran treatment for PH1 had acceptable safety and led to sustained and substantial reduction of UOx with preservation of kidney function.
